Pharmaceutical plants are highly regulated environments where the production, storage, and handling of drugs require strict adherence to safety and hygiene standards. Explosion proof lighting is an essential component in these plants, as it not only ensures the safety of workers but also protects the integrity of pharmaceutical products from potential hazards associated with electrical malfunctions and explosive atmospheres.
The construction of explosion proof lighting for pharmaceutical plants must comply with stringent safety regulations, including those related to the pharmaceutical industry and general explosion - proof standards. The enclosures of the lighting fixtures are typically made from materials that are both durable and easy to clean, such as stainless steel. Stainless steel offers excellent corrosion resistance, which is vital in pharmaceutical plants where chemicals and cleaning agents are commonly used. It also has a smooth surface that prevents the accumulation of dust, dirt, and bacteria, helping to maintain a clean and sterile environment. These enclosures are engineered to withstand the pressures and temperatures generated by an internal explosion, ensuring that any electrical faults within the light do not pose a threat to the surrounding pharmaceutical production areas.
Sealing and protection of electrical components are of utmost importance in pharmaceutical plant lighting. High - performance gaskets and seals create an airtight barrier around the lighting units, preventing the entry of flammable gases, vapors, and particulate matter. In a pharmaceutical plant, even a small amount of dust or a flammable substance entering the lighting system can contaminate the drug production process or pose an explosion risk. The electrical components are carefully designed and shielded to eliminate the risk of sparking or arcing. All electrical connections are insulated, grounded, and often enclosed in explosion - proof junction boxes to further enhance safety.
Functionally, explosion proof lighting in pharmaceutical plants comes in various forms to meet different lighting needs. In production areas, high - bay lights are used to provide broad illumination, ensuring that workers can clearly see the manufacturing processes and quality control checks. Task lighting is installed in areas where precision work is carried out, such as laboratories and formulation rooms, to offer focused and adjustable lighting for tasks like analyzing samples and preparing drug formulations. Additionally, many pharmaceutical plants are now adopting LED - based explosion proof lighting due to its energy - efficient and long - lasting properties. LED lights consume less electricity, reducing the overall energy costs of the plant. Their long lifespan also means fewer replacements, minimizing the risk of contamination during maintenance activities. Regular inspection and maintenance of explosion proof lighting in pharmaceutical plants are necessary to ensure compliance with safety and hygiene standards, protecting the quality of pharmaceutical products and the well - being of workers.
